色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

MySQL使用文本文件導入記錄

黃萬煥1年前8瀏覽0評論

MySQL是一種流行的關系型數據庫,它可以使用多種方式導入數據。本文將介紹如何使用文本文件導入記錄到MySQL中。

1. 準備數據文件。
為了能夠導入數據到MySQL中,首先需要準備好數據文件。數據文件可以是純文本文件,以逗號或制表符進行分隔,并且文件中每行都包含一個記錄。
2. 創建表格。
在將數據導入MySQL之前,必須先創建一個對應的表格。可以使用CREATE TABLE語句來創建表格。創建表格可以通過命令行或者其他客戶端工具實現。
例如,以下是一個創建表格的示例代碼:
CREATE TABLE users (
id INT(6) UNSIGNED AUTO_INCREMENT PRIMARY KEY,
firstname VARCHAR(30) NOT NULL,
lastname VARCHAR(30) NOT NULL,
email VARCHAR(50)
);
這個示例代碼創建了一個名為“users”的表格,其中包含了四個字段:id、firstname、lastname和email。其中,id是一個自增字段,并被設置為主鍵。
3. 導入數據。
在準備好了數據文件和表格之后,就可以將數據導入到MySQL中了。MySQL提供了LOAD DATA INFILE語句來實現將數據文件中的數據導入到表格中。
例如,以下是一個將數據文件導入MySQL的示例代碼:
LOAD DATA INFILE '/tmp/data.txt' INTO TABLE users
FIELDS TERMINATED BY ',' 
LINES TERMINATED BY '\n'
IGNORE 1 ROWS;
這個示例代碼將數據文件“/tmp/data.txt”中的數據導入到表格“users”中。該語句使用了“FIELDS TERMINATED BY”和“LINES TERMINATED BY”關鍵字來指定數據文件中的字段分隔符和行分隔符。還使用了一個“IGNORE 1 ROWS”關鍵字來跳過文件中的第一行(通常是頭文件)。
4. 驗證數據。
成功導入數據后,可以使用SELECT語句來驗證數據。
例如,以下是一個使用SELECT語句來驗證導入數據的示例代碼:
SELECT * FROM users;
這個示例代碼將查詢表格“users”中的所有記錄,并將結果返回給MySQL客戶端。

使用文本文件導入記錄是MySQL中的一種非常實用的功能,可以快速、簡單地導入大量數據。通過以上步驟,您可以輕松地將數據導入MySQL,以便進行后續的數據操作。